Well, i just set up my aquapod 24g thursday. Had to rearrange my room which made a difference in everything haha. But i finally did it with my friends help. Looks great now! Just swapped everything from my 20L.

Equipment/Lighting:I have a jbj viper 150w light with 14k lamp. I have a tunze DOC 9002 skimmer in the overflow chamber in the back. For the return i have a rio 600gph pump going to a dual locline. Inside the tank i have a koralia 2 for added flow. also a 100w heater. I also have a cpr bak-pak for a bak up.

Fish:Right now i have an occelaris clown pair, a black and white and an orange and white misbar, a yellow watchman goby, and a peppermint shrimp. Not sure if ill go with more but i'd love a nice looking wrasse. Any suggestions?

Coral stocking:I plan on making this tank a mixed tank but mostly sps and lps :rock: which i tried a back in march but i think my tank wasn't mature enough as everything rtn'd on me.:hmpf: but im ready for them this time lol. I have two clams now, 4 rics, mushrooms left from before and some palys from before, and my red pavona....this thing never dies lol. I also have a purple polyp digi now which i have always wanted. So...time to start stocking. I will post pics tonight or tomorrow.

Still Need: I Still need a chiller haha. And a titanium heater. Dont like temp swings....they scare me lol. And i wanna get a spare bulb. Anything else you guys think? Lmk thanks.
